So here we are again and first up this great blues album from one of the finest guitarists of the genre and certainly the greatest to hail from Texas. The opening track sets the scene on this 10th studio album and sadly the last as he was to die only two years later. Listening to this album clearly shows he was no sideman ! Great feeling and explosive riffs from his Fender Telecaster accompanied by fine vocals from the man himself and aided by some great blues muscians including Johnny B. Garden on Bass, Soko Richardson on Drums, Debbie Davies on Rythm Guitar and Eddie Harsch on Keyboards.

Next we go to one of my all time favourite rock bands and whether its the early 70's band created from the ashes of the Santana Abraxas band or the later hugely successful 80's incarnation, they epitomise American AOR. The most notable track from the album is of course "Don't Stop Believin" which in 2009 eighteen years after its release became the biggest selling tune on iTunes and also the biggest selling track not released in the 21st Century, with over 1 Billion Streams and 7 million downloads and named the biggest selling track of all time by Forbes ! The band has also sold over 100 million albums worldwide making them one of the worlds biggest selling bands of all time.
